Pep Guardiola has been pictured receiving yet another parking fine in Manchester's city centre.

In August, Guardiola held a hilarious exchange with a traffic warden after being handed a parking ticket for leaving his car on a double yellow line.

This time round, however, there were less jokes involved as the Manchester City boss received his latest punishment on Sunday afternoon.

The former Barcelona and Bayern Munich boss was seemingly out in Manchester's city centre to do some holiday shopping.

However, when he returned, saw that he had been issued a £60 parking ticket for parking his car on a double yellow line for three hours.

Guardiola was seen stepping out of his electric Nissan before heading into tapas bar Tast Catala, which he owns, before heading out for some shopping.

It came just one day after Guardiola's City side were held to a 1-1 draw with league rivals Liverpool - following goals from Erling Haaland and Trent Alexander-Arnold.

After the final whistle, Liverpool star Darwin Nunez and Guardiola were involved in a heated post-match spat at the Etihad on Saturday afternoon.

Immediately after the match, Guardiola and Jurgen Klopp were seen shaking hands following the draw.

But Nunez, 24, appeared to have been infuriated by City boss as he went over to the Spaniard - with the pair being involved in an animated exchange of words.

As Guardiola walked back to his car in Manchester, a traffic warden handed him a ticket and proceeded to ask him for a photograph.

As captured on TikTok, the Man City manager joked in response: 'You want a picture? You have to pay for the picture!'
